Our hotel ratings and reviews are from real hotel guests. Priceline.com ensures that its reviews are guests-only by proactively sending hotel surveys to customers after they've completed their hotel stays. In the post-stay surveys, priceline.com hotel customers are asked a number of questions about their stay and the hotel. On a scale of 1-10 with 10 being the best, the survey asks guests to rate their overall experience and specifically rate the hotel's cleanliness, staff and location. Good value, by and large. However, internet connectivity was intermittent (a definite negative, since stay was mostly for work). Also, noise from the adjoining room transmitted to ours, like the walls were made of paper. Fortunately, there were rarely guests next door, and they infrequently talked. Finally, our AC broke down, though that, unlike our internet connection, was fixed pronto by a Wyndham technician.

Seems quite nice. It's slightly different feel than a hotel as this is a time share resort. Had a difficult time just finding out what the phone number was for the front desk for the Wyndham Grand Desert in Las Vegas did not have it's own website, instead the only website was the website for the headquarters and I had to phone them to get the number. This is a time share resort so the experience is slightly different. Well maintained and comfortable, but a bit weird getting to upper floors as we had to go through a garage to get to elevators. After checking in, as we headed to our room, there was a guest who was drunk and he fell down in the middle of hall way blocking our path. I guess this isn't the hotel's problem, but not the best impression. My partner said the room smelled as if someone had cooked fish before and kept telling me that but I didn't really detect it as I had sinus allergies. The bathroom only had one sink and seemed outdated. Kitchen was nice and fully equipped, although outdated, it had everything and was well designed. I can reach the upper cupboards. Didn't like the fact a group of young men starting playing catch in the adult pool, since people didn't have room to swim while they were playing there and no one told them to stop. Lounges were very comfy, and had plenty. It's a decent place. As we left, we were going to take a cab to the MGM as we had planned to stay there and Wyndham offered to take us there in their limo, no charge, just pay driver with a tip.
